The Poland Antenna Market is projected to witness mixed growth rate patterns during 2025 to 2029. Commencing at 1.99% in 2025, growth builds up to 3.46% by 2029.
By 2027, Poland's Antenna market is forecasted to achieve a stable growth rate of 1.92%, with Germany leading the Europe region, followed by United Kingdom, France, Italy and Russia.
The Poland Antenna Market is experiencing steady growth driven by the increasing demand for advanced communication systems in the country. The market is characterized by a wide range of antenna types such as indoor, outdoor, satellite, and automotive antennas catering to various industries including telecommunications, automotive, aerospace, and defense. With the rising adoption of smart devices, IoT technologies, and the deployment of 5G networks, the demand for antennas is expected to further escalate in the coming years. Key market players in Poland include PCTEL, Kathrein, Amphenol, and Laird Technologies, who are focusing on innovation and product development to gain a competitive edge. Government initiatives to expand broadband coverage and enhance communication infrastructure are also driving the growth of the antenna market in Poland.

Government policies related to the Poland Antenna Market primarily focus on promoting the adoption of digital technologies and ensuring efficient use of radio frequency spectrum. The Office of Electronic Communications (UKE) in Poland regulates the telecommunications sector, including antennas, to ensure fair competition and consumer protection. The government has also implemented policies to support the development of 5G infrastructure, which has led to an increased demand for antennas capable of supporting this technology. Additionally, there are regulations in place to address environmental concerns related to the installation of antennas, such as restrictions on where antennas can be placed to minimize visual impact and potential health risks. Overall, the government policies aim to facilitate the growth of the antenna market in Poland while ensuring compliance with regulatory standards and promoting technological advancements.
